Advancement #1: 3D Printing for Customized Implants

One of the most exciting recent advancements in orthopedic implant technology is 3D printing. This technology allows doctors to create customized implants that fit a patient's unique anatomy and needs. Using high-resolution imaging and computer modeling, doctors can design a custom implant that perfectly matches the patient's bone structure and joint mechanics. These implants can improve implant stability, reduce the risk of complications, and help patients recover faster. Advancement #2: Biodegradable Implants

Another emerging trend in orthopaedic implant technology is the development of biodegradable implants. These implants are designed to break down over time, gradually replaced by new tissue as the body heals. While still in the experimental stage, these biodegradable implants have the potential to reduce the risk of implant rejection, improve long-term outcomes, and eliminate the need for additional surgeries to remove the implant.

Advancement #3: Smart Implants

Smart implants are another exciting area of development in orthopedic implant technology. These implants contain sensors and microchips that can monitor the implant's performance and send data to doctors in real-time. This technology can help doctors identify potential problems before they become serious, track the healing process, and make adjustments to the patient's treatment plan as needed.

Advancement #4: Additive Manufacturing Techniques

Additive manufacturing is another area of innovation in orthopedic implant technology. This process uses 3D printing and other techniques to create complex geometries and surface textures that can improve implant performance and reduce the risk of complications. Additive manufacturing techniques can also reduce the production time and cost of implants, making them more accessible to patients.
